python3-repoze.lru-0.6-4.lbn25.py37.noarch
repoze.lru is a LRU (least recently used) cache implementation. Keys and values that are not used frequently will be evicted from the cache faster than keys and values that are used frequently. It works under Python 2.5, Python 2.6, Python 2.7, and Python 3.2.

python3-requests-credssp-2.0.0-8.lbn36.noarch
This package allows for HTTPS CredSSP authentication using the requests
library. CredSSP is a Microsoft authentication that allows your credentials
to be delegated to a server giving you double hop authentication.

python3-requests-download-0.1.2-8.fc36.noarch
A convenient function to download to a file using requests.
Basic usage:
url = "https://github.com/takluyver/requests_download/archive/master.zip"
download(url, "requests_download.zip")
An optional headers= parameter is passed through to requests.
